Output c8d072dd7747e7392f858bfb4cce48ecb80761781983065b652f1815010ec043:20

value
38990345
script pubkey
OP_0 OP_PUSHBYTES_20 8faf8445f98ac7a6f10c6792502976b145187521
address
bc1q37hcg30e3tr6dugvv7f9q2tkk9z3safp9wk88h
transaction
c8d072dd7747e7392f858bfb4cce48ecb80761781983065b652f1815010ec043
confirmations
118254
spent
true